As Cuyahoga County awaits Executive Chris Ronayne’s plans for how to improve conditions in the jail, there appears to be a growing movement to simultaneously overhaul the sheriff’s department.

CLEVELAND, Ohio – after former Interim Sheriff Steven Hammett abruptly resigned. He was the sixth sheriff to resign since the formation of the new county government.

The ordinance amendment was introduced on Tuesday and will go before council’s Public Safety and Justice Affairs Committee, which Gallagher chairs, for discussion and consideration at 1 p.m. on Tuesday.elevated the sheriff to a chief-level position with more direct access to his office “I wake up some days and say, ‘should I recommend that the sheriff be fired?’ and I don’t really have anybody to ask,” Sweeney said during the meeting.

It has received 447 signatures as of Thursday, many of them from current or former corrections officers.But in the absence of an elected sheriff, removing the sheriff from under the executive and granting them independent powers might be the closest the position comes to being autonomous under the current charter, Gallagher said.
